Pool Fence Installation in Salem
When searching for pool fence installation in Salem, Oregon, it's important to consider the type of fencing that best suits your needs, such as chain link, wood, or PVC. Local fence contractors can provide repair services, and factors like material and labor costs will influence the overall price. For repair work, assess whether a full replacement might be more cost-effective in the long run.

FAQ
How much does it cost to repair a fence in Salem, Oregon?
Repair costs vary based on the extent of damage and materials. On average, you might expect to pay between $150 and $500 for minor repairs, but for extensive damage, replacement might be more economical. Contact local contractors in Salem for accurate estimates.
Can I repair a fence myself in Salem, Oregon?
Some minor repairs like fixing a loose board or gate hinge can be DIY, but for structural issues or if you're unsure, it's best to hire a professional in Salem. This ensures safety and proper workmanship.
Does homeowners insurance cover fence repair in Salem, Oregon?
Coverage depends on your policy. Fence repair is typically covered if the damage is from a covered peril like a storm, but not for wear and tear. Check with your insurance provider to see what's included for homes in Salem.
Is it cheaper to repair or replace a fence in Salem, Oregon?
It depends on the damage and age of the fence. If repairs are less than 50% of replacement cost and the fence is structurally sound, repairing may be cheaper. For older fences, replacement might be more cost-effective in the long run.
